Teresa returned in December 2025 from South Korea Exhibiting by invitation for the second year at the Sadaemun International Artists Community Exhibition. She will return to South Korea in July 2026 for her solo exhibition ‘dance of chromaphilia’.
Teresa’s art studies began at St George TAFE Sydney, obtaining a Fine Art Certificate followed by Graphic Design Certificate at Randwick TAFE in 1985.
She returned to study fine art in 2015 and gained her Diploma of Visual Art at Nambour TAFE and was awarded the Eckersley’s Prize. In 2021 she joined ArtschoolCo Studio classes in Buderim Queensland with Jessica LeClerc where she is continuing to develop her style.
Teresa won the 2022 Encouragement award at Kenilworth Artfest Queensland for her oil painting ‘glass concerto’. She exhibited and was a finalist in many art competitions in Brisbane and the Sunshine Coast, most recently in 2025 winning the pastel section of the Royal Queensland Art Society’s 135th Members Annual – A mix of media exhibition at Petrie Terrace Gallery, Brisbane.
In August 2025 Teresa had a dual solo exhibition at Talented Friends Gallery in Caloundra. Apart from Australia and South Korea, Teresa has also exhibited in Japan. The focus of her work is movement and ballet, and she predominantly works in Pastel.
